Clean up diff file header CSS
- Remove all css for file headers in
diff.scsstofiles.scss - Remove duplicated css in
files.scss. Since.file-titleand.file-title-flex-parentare always on the same element, these two blocks are actually duplicated. - Make all heights align with
8pxgrid system (https://design.gitlab.com/layout/spacing)- Button group height is
30px -
5pxpadding should be8px,12pxor16px
- Button group height is
-
bonus: remove
-1pxhacks all over the diff nav header
Places to look for regressions
- MR diffs
- Compare versions
- view commit
- Readme on project home page
- view file
- Edit file
Edited by 🤖 GitLab Bot 🤖